Germany - Import of Flexible Plastic Tubes, Pipes and Hoses, Having a Minimum Burst Pressure of 27.6 Mpa
Since 2014, Germany Import of Flexible Plastic Tubes, Pipes and Hoses, Having a Minimum Burst Pressure of 27.6 Mpa jumped by 0.9% year on year. With $65,791,360.34 in 2019, the country was number 4 among other countries in Import of Flexible Plastic Tubes, Pipes and Hoses, Having a Minimum Burst Pressure of 27.6 Mpa. Germany is overtaken by United States, which was ranked number 3 with $110,555,732.83 and is followed by Belgium at $45,547,630.18. France lead the ranking with $119,852,261.42 in 2019, a growth of 0.2% versus 2018. Dominican Republic recorded the best 5 years average growth at +94.7% per year, while Central African Republic was the worst growing country at -46.3% per year.
